Abstract
The purpose of this study was to investigate the spray structure and evaporation characteristics for a use in a common rail direct injection type HCCI (Homogeneous Charge Compression Ignition) engine. In this study, we measured the injection rate and visualized the spray structure of a HCCI injector. In addition, a CFD simulation for mixture formation was conducted to compare the simulation result with experimental result. From the result, we found that the spray penetration was propotional to ¼ exponent of back pressure. The result also indicated that the injection time and file I component have a great role in evaporation rate and mixture distribution.
